Festivale Furniture Items

There will be a series of items that are available for you to pick up from Nook’s Cranny starting February 1st through the 15th. Each day you will be able to purchase one item, and the item will change out daily until you collect them all. After you have collected each of them, they will start to rotate.

The collection of items comes in one of four colors: blue, red, green, or purple. The color selection is made at random, and you won’t be able to change the color that is assigned to your island. It is also important to note that you can not purchase additional items from the ABD or the shopping app – you are actually limited to the single quantity that is available in Nook’s. This limit also applies if you have multiple residents on your island – you still only get one. Here is a list of the items that will be available for you to purchase:

Festivale Stage

Festivale Stage

The stage will cost 6,000 Bells. The stage is absolutely fabulous and a must-have for your festivale partying. When you run across the stage, the feathers will blow in the breeze left in your wake!

It appears that they will take feathers to customize, rather than just customization packets, which is not unlike the items over Halloween which required pumpkins. Feathers don’t seem to be available just yet, and we can only assume that they will become available on the day of the actual festivale.

Festivale Parasol

Festivale Parasol

You can purchase the parasol for 2,500 Bells from Nook’s Cranny. It’s a very cute parasol, but doesn’t have any additional actions when you place it.

Festivale Drum

Festivale Drum

You can purchase the drum for 2,100 Bells from Nook’s Cranny. The drum is extra amazing because you can play it!

Festivale Garland

Festivale Garland

The garland will run you 4,000 Bells. It’s pretty and makes great decor, but has no action after you place it.

Festivale Lamp

Festivale Lamp

The lamp will be 1,500 Bells. Like most lamps, you will be able to turn the light and of as needed.

Festivale Stall

Festivale Stall

The stall will cost you 3,000 Bells. It is the same size as a stall you can build, but a bit more decorative. As with other stalls, you are able to place two small items or a single larger item on it.

Festivale Flag

Festivale Flag

The flag is 1,300 Bells and blows beautifully in the wind.

Festivale Balloon Lamp

Festivale Balloon Lamp

It is 4,000 Bells for this balloon lamp. It doesn’t do much other than look pretty.

Festivale Confetti Machine

Festivale Confetti Machine

This 5,000 Bell machine might be my favorite piece! Buy it, place, turn it on and enjoy the confetti! It never turns off! It’s beautiful!

Festivale Clothing

There are a three items of clothing that you can obtain to help in your party as well. Like the furniture, they’ll come in four variations – but you’ll be able to purchase all of them from Able Sisters. You’ll find a Festivale accessory, costume, and tank dress!

Festivale Reactions

In addition to the new furniture items and clothing, there are some new reactions! You can buy the pack of them from Nook’s Cranny, and they are actually really adorable. If you have ever wanted to dance with your villagers, now is your chance!
